Fix for 95827, adds API for registering "AccessibleDeviceListeners"
[platform/core/uifw/at-spi2-atk.git] / docs / reference / cspi / tmpl / spi_registry.sgml
index cf984ce..f9cc3f7 100644 (file)
@@ -23,8 +23,9 @@ Registry queries
 @SPI_KEY_RELEASE: 
 @SPI_KEY_PRESSRELEASE: 
 @SPI_KEY_SYM: 
+@SPI_KEY_STRING: 
 
-<!-- ##### FUNCTION getDesktopCount ##### -->
+<!-- ##### FUNCTION SPI_getDesktopCount ##### -->
 <para>
 
 </para>
@@ -32,7 +33,7 @@ Registry queries
 @Returns: 
 
 
-<!-- ##### FUNCTION getDesktop ##### -->
+<!-- ##### FUNCTION SPI_getDesktop ##### -->
 <para>
 
 </para>
@@ -41,13 +42,23 @@ Registry queries
 @Returns: 
 
 
-<!-- ##### FUNCTION getDesktopList ##### -->
+<!-- ##### FUNCTION SPI_getDesktopList ##### -->
 <para>
 
 </para>
 
-@list: 
+@desktop_list: 
 @Returns: 
+<!-- # Unused Parameters # -->
+@list: 
+
+
+<!-- ##### FUNCTION SPI_freeDesktopList ##### -->
+<para>
+
+</para>
+
+@desktop_list: 
 
 
 <!-- ##### USER_FUNCTION AccessibleKeystrokeListenerCB ##### -->
@@ -56,6 +67,7 @@ Registry queries
 </para>
 
 @stroke: 
+@user_data: 
 @Returns: 
 
 
@@ -71,13 +83,11 @@ Registry queries
 </para>
 
 
-<!-- ##### ENUM AccessibleKeyEventType ##### -->
+<!-- ##### TYPEDEF AccessibleKeyEventType ##### -->
 <para>
 
 </para>
 
-@SPI_KEY_PRESSED: 
-@SPI_KEY_RELEASED: 
 
 <!-- ##### ENUM AccessibleKeyListenerSyncType ##### -->
 <para>
@@ -89,16 +99,50 @@ Registry queries
 @SPI_KEYLISTENER_CANCONSUME: 
 @SPI_KEYLISTENER_ALL_WINDOWS: 
 
-<!-- ##### FUNCTION createAccessibleKeystrokeListener ##### -->
+<!-- ##### TYPEDEF AccessibleKeystroke ##### -->
+<para>
+
+</para>
+
+
+<!-- ##### MACRO SPI_KEYSET_ALL_KEYS ##### -->
+<para>
+
+</para>
+
+
+
+<!-- ##### FUNCTION SPI_createAccessibleKeySet ##### -->
+<para>
+
+</para>
+
+@len: 
+@keysyms: 
+@keycodes: 
+@keystrings: 
+@Returns: 
+
+
+<!-- ##### FUNCTION SPI_freeAccessibleKeySet ##### -->
+<para>
+
+</para>
+
+@keyset: 
+
+
+<!-- ##### FUNCTION SPI_createAccessibleKeystrokeListener ##### -->
 <para>
 
 </para>
 
 @callback: 
+@user_data: 
 @Returns: 
 
 
-<!-- ##### FUNCTION registerGlobalEventListener ##### -->
+<!-- ##### FUNCTION SPI_registerGlobalEventListener ##### -->
 <para>
 
 </para>
@@ -108,7 +152,7 @@ Registry queries
 @Returns: 
 
 
-<!-- ##### FUNCTION deregisterGlobalEventListener ##### -->
+<!-- ##### FUNCTION SPI_deregisterGlobalEventListener ##### -->
 <para>
 
 </para>
@@ -118,7 +162,7 @@ Registry queries
 @Returns: 
 
 
-<!-- ##### FUNCTION deregisterGlobalEventListenerAll ##### -->
+<!-- ##### FUNCTION SPI_deregisterGlobalEventListenerAll ##### -->
 <para>
 
 </para>
@@ -127,7 +171,7 @@ Registry queries
 @Returns: 
 
 
-<!-- ##### FUNCTION registerAccessibleKeystrokeListener ##### -->
+<!-- ##### FUNCTION SPI_registerAccessibleKeystrokeListener ##### -->
 <para>
 
 </para>
@@ -137,15 +181,25 @@ Registry queries
 @modmask: 
 @eventmask: 
 @sync_type: 
+@Returns: 
 
 
-<!-- ##### FUNCTION deregisterAccessibleKeystrokeListener ##### -->
+<!-- ##### FUNCTION SPI_deregisterAccessibleKeystrokeListener ##### -->
 <para>
 
 </para>
 
 @listener: 
 @modmask: 
+@Returns: 
+
+
+<!-- ##### FUNCTION AccessibleKeystrokeListener_unref ##### -->
+<para>
+
+</para>
+
+@listener: 
 
 
 <!-- ##### FUNCTION AccessibleKeystrokeListener_removeCallback ##### -->
@@ -165,19 +219,22 @@ Registry queries
 
 @listener: 
 @callback: 
+@user_data: 
 @Returns: 
 
 
-<!-- ##### FUNCTION generateKeyEvent ##### -->
+<!-- ##### FUNCTION SPI_generateKeyboardEvent ##### -->
 <para>
 
 </para>
 
 @keyval: 
+@keystring: 
 @synth_type: 
+@Returns: 
 
 
-<!-- ##### FUNCTION generateMouseEvent ##### -->
+<!-- ##### FUNCTION SPI_generateMouseEvent ##### -->
 <para>
 
 </para>
@@ -185,5 +242,6 @@ Registry queries
 @x: 
 @y: 
 @name: 
+@Returns: